FMI Appoints Director, Food Safety Programs

The Food Marketing Institute (FMI), based in Arlington, Va., has named Josh Katz its new director of food safety programs. Reporting to Hilary Thesmar, FMI’s VP of food safety programs, Katz will play a major role in the development and implementation of critical food safety initiatives.

“Josh brings to FMI more than 13 years of robust academic and professional experience, including in-depth knowledge of designing food safety and quality systems,” noted Thesmar. “Food safety is of upmost importance to our members, and Josh’s farm-to-fork experience will become a valuable asset to our retailers.”

Katz recently earned his doctorate at University of California-Davis in nutritional biology, specializing in human health risk assessment. During his studies, he wrote or co-wrote five publications probing the effect of diet on such consumer issues as food safety (pesticides, acrylamide, cyanide) and nutrition. Before earning his degree, Katz spent eight years in the food safety assessment industry, first with The Steritech Group and then with Davis Fresh Technologies.
